Neighborhood Overview
Plumstead Christian School is situated in the scenic and quiet landscape of Chalfont, Pennsylvania, within Bucks County. The campus is accessible primarily via local roads like New Galena Road, which connects to the broader regional highway network including Route 202 and Route 611. Visitors coming from Philadelphia International Airport (PHL) should expect a drive of approximately 60 to 75 minutes depending on traffic conditions and time of day. The area is largely residential and semi-rural, meaning that private vehicle transportation is the most reliable way to navigate the region. Parking is available on-site, though space can become limited during high-attendance events or multiple concurrent school activities.
For those relying on rideshare services, please note that availability in this part of Bucks County can be inconsistent compared to major metropolitan centers. It is strongly recommended to schedule your transport in advance if you are not using a personal vehicle. Arrival tactics should prioritize early departure, as local two-lane roads can experience minor congestion when school sessions conclude or large events begin. Always look for signage directing visitors to the appropriate parking lots to ensure you are as close to the facility entrance as possible. Efficient movement throughout the neighborhood is best achieved by remaining aware of the school zone speed limits and local traffic patterns.
Where to Stay
Accommodations near Plumstead Christian School are primarily located in the surrounding towns of Doylestown, Hatfield, and Montgomeryville, which offer a variety of hotel options. These clusters provide a mix of standard lodging and suites that are well-suited for traveling teams or family groups needing multiple rooms. While there are no hotels within immediate walking distance of the school, most properties in the nearby towns are a short 10 to 20-minute drive away. Teams often prefer staying in Doylestown for its balance of accessibility to the school and proximity to local dining and shopping districts.
Demand for local lodging can spike during regional tournament weekends or major school calendar events, so booking well in advance is highly recommended. When selecting your hotel, consider properties that offer breakfast and proximity to major arterial roads to simplify your morning commute. If you are traveling as a large group, coordinate with the hotel sales teams to ensure your rooms are clustered together for easier logistics. Utilizing online travel platforms to filter for amenities like fitness centers or meeting rooms can further improve your group's overall comfort during your stay.

Mercer Museum
3.5 miLocated in nearby Doylestown, this unique museum features a massive collection of pre-industrial tools and historical artifacts. The castle-like architecture is an attraction in itself, making it a must-see for visitors interested in history and design. You can spend several hours exploring the multi-story exhibits that highlight the ingenuity of early American life. It is an excellent choice for an educational and engaging outing away from the sports complex. The museum offers a deep dive into the heritage of the region.
Fonthill Castle
3.8 miFonthill Castle is a historic home built by Henry Chapman Mercer, showcasing his unique style of reinforced concrete architecture. The interior is filled with elaborate tiles and distinct decorative elements that make every room a work of art. Guided tours are available and provide fascinating insight into the life and vision of its creator. It stands as a testament to the artistic history of the area and is a popular destination for tourists. The surrounding grounds are also beautifully landscaped for a pleasant walk.
